Overview
Kleinfelder is seeking qualified, responsible candidates for the position of Special Inspector/Materials Testing Technicians to work on projects in the Bowling Green, Ohio metropolitan area. This role involves actively engaging on construction sites performing special inspections and testing of construction materials in the field. This position can be full-time, part-time, or flex.
Responsibilities- Perform field observations and materials sampling/testing during construction of buildings, bridges, and roadways.
- Perform testing on construction materials including soils, reinforcing steel, concrete, masonry, structural steel, fireproofing, metal decking, and paving.
- Write daily field reports documenting work performed by the various contractors and indicating compliance/non-compliance with contract documents.
- Cast field samples of concrete, masonry, grout, etc. for strength verification.
- Provide daily communication to the Department Manager to inform of daily project progress.
- Pickup construction material samples and deliver to laboratory; deliver equipment to site technicians.

- 2+ years of special inspection and/or construction materials testing experience (or equivalent).
- Radiation safety training for the operation of a nuclear density gauge (if applicable).
- ACI Concrete Field-Testing Technician - Grade 1 or equivalent certification.
- Valid driver's license and clean driving record.
- Proficiency with a company-provided laptop or tablet and MS Office (Word, Excel, Outlook).
- High school diploma or equivalent.
- A strong work ethic and high level of personal integrity.
- Ability to monitor contractors and report results verbally and in writing.
- Ability to prepare clear and accurate reports and maintain work activity records.
- Attention to detail, quality, and safety.
- Authorization to work in the United States.
- ICC Special Inspector Certifications (Reinforced Concrete, Pre-stressed Concrete, Soil, Spray-applied Fireproofing, Structural Masonry, Structural Welding, Structural Steel and Bolting).
- Certified Welding Inspector (CWI) – American Welding Society (AWS).
- Bend, stoop, and lift up to 50 pounds repeatedly; may lift more with handling equipment.
- Operate heavy equipment as necessary (e.g., ultrasonic testing devices, concrete cylinder presses).
- Maintain mobility over construction terrain, including ladders and uneven surfaces.
- Work outdoors in variable weather and in labs with safety protections as required.
